Apple vs. Meta
Apple’s recent privacy changes have drastically impacted digital advertising, with users opting out of tracking 84% of the time. This shift has led to skyrocketing customer acquisition costs for businesses and a significant decline in Meta’s earnings, which plummeted 52% year on year.
